JOHN R. HOOVER, SR., passed peacefully into the arms of Jesus, June 16, 2014, after a long battle with Alzheimer’s. His family finds comfort knowing John was a believer in his Savior Jesus Christ. John was born to Herbert and Dorothy Hoover on June 21, 1936, in Dover, Ohio and moved to Florida in 1959. He proudly served in the Navy as Radio Operator from February 1954 to June 1957. John retired from the Miami Herald in January 2000, where he started his career as Apprentice Printer and during his distinguished 41 year tenure advanced to the position of Quality Assurance Manager. Prior to his illness he was extremely active and loved to fish, take walks, golf, play guitar, and most importantly loved to spend time with his family. John loved to work with the youth as President and Coach of Little League at S.W.B.J.A.A. Miramar, as well as with underpriviledged children through various groups sponsored by the Miami Herald.
